brochure a small booklet or pamphlet, especially one that contains pictures and is used for advertising purposes.
despondent low in spirits; unhappy, depressed, or dejected.
determinant that which is a factor in causing an outcome.
drone2 to talk in a boring voice without changing one's tone.
exaggerate to present as larger, more important, or more valuable.
faulty having imperfections, flaws, or defects.
indirect not in a straight line, course, or route.
institute to bring into being or set in operation.
mastery the full grasp of a subject or skill.
politics the work or study of government.
populate to live in; inhabit.
premium the exceptional value or esteem accorded something.
rampage a course of angry, violent, or destructive behavior.
stimulate to bring about to activity or action.
stimulus something that causes or increases action, feeling, or thought.
